Obituary of Ki Tai Pae

Ki-Tai Pae 87, formerly of Newington and Glastonbury, passed away peacefully on May 4, 2024 with family by his side. He was born in Korea on October 18, 1936 and moved to the United States to obtain his doctoral degree. Ki-Tai was a lifelong scholar and educator. He received his PhD from the University of Connecticut, completed a postdoctoral fellowship at Yale, and was proficient in six languages. For almost 40 years he was a Professor of Economics at Central Connecticut State University and was Chairperson of the department for many years. He was always willing to share his wisdom and his smile.

Ki-Tai was predeceased by his wife, Susan Sook-Hee, in 2015. They were married for 52 years and shared a love for the outdoors, especially hiking the numerous trails of the White Mountains and visiting national parks. Ki-Tai is survived by his son, Robert Pae MD, and his wife Connie, of New York; his daughter, Kathy Pae MD and her husband, Barrett Wells, of Glastonbury; and three beloved grandsons: Jonathan and Brian Pae and Kory Wells.
